How working with me is different
We start by naming the solution you need
A lot of people say “I need an accountant,” but that can mean needing help with bookkeeping (accuracy), finances (decisions), or taxes (compliance).
My first job is helping you name the real problem so you can find the right solution.

Q: Do you do taxes?
No, but I make tax time a lot less awful. I keep your bookkeeping clean and organized so you show up to your tax pro with solid numbers, not a mess to sort through first.
That means accurate, up-to-date books, income and expenses categorized correctly, clean reports ready to hand off, and anything confusing flagged before it becomes a surprise.
If you already have a tax preparer, great. If you don't, I can help you know what to look for and refer you to ones I trust.
